Noun [English]

Forms: design codes [plural]
Head templates: {{en-noun}} design code (plural design codes)
  1. A set of rules on design of buildings and public spaces. Translations (regulations on design): suunnittelusäännöstö (Finnish), дизайн-код (dizajn-kod) (Russian)
